We had torrential rain for the first three hours of my work day & temp was 40. It was cold. But the rain stopped. One of my customers wanted me to make him 2 Bubinga/ebony ring bowls so about a week & a half I delivered them, he also wanted two Wallstreet pens with his father in law to be name engraved on them. I used cut offs from the Bubinga for one of the pens & I had some Amboyna burl for the other one. I used a black & a black Ti kits & had Ryan at Woodturningz engrave them with color fill. They came our perfectly. He gave me $250 for the items. I thought that was a decent price for the two bowls & engraved pens. He loved the bowls & the pens & thought the price was more then fair for home made turnings. So a day that started out bad turned good. It helps with the piggy bank for tool purchases.
